On 10/16/07, Stephen Neuendorffer <stephen.neuendorffer@xilinx.com> wrote:
> On a similar note, is there interest in actually factoring the device
> tree code out from the different architectures into a common codebase?

It's already happened somewhat.  (Look in drivers/of and include/linux/of*.h)

However, I don't think any of the stuff specific to flattened device
trees is being factored out of arch/powerpc yet.
